"Ichiban Kirei na Watashi o" (一番綺麗な私を?, "The Most Beautiful Me") is the thirty-second single by Japanese singer Mika Nakashima. Released on August 25, 2010, it was the theme song for the TBS TV series, Unubore Deka (うぬぼれ刑事?, Conceited Detective).[1] Nakashima played the supporting role of Rie Hagurashi in the TV series.
This song has been noted for its "old-sounding" tune reminiscent of 20th-century Japanese pop songs, such as Teresa Teng's; J-pop hit songs have mostly been under the strong influence of electronic elements from the likes of synth pop, techno, hip hop and eurobeat since the 1990s.[2]

"Ichiban Kirei na Watashi o" was certified platinum for Chaku-Uta Full sales of over 250,000.[3]
Usen Chart (Japan) [edit]
It reached the top spot of the Usen Chart and stayed there for five consecutive weeks.[4]
